Hm. You don't seem to have linux-image-generic installed. The way kernel
upgrades work is via the linux-image-generic meta package. linux-image-
generic depends on the latest linux-image- *and* linux-modules-
extra- [1]. Whenever we release new kernels we also release an
updated linux-image-generic
